I wanted to know how to upgrade the OS on my MP-7. And why do I need 
to upgrade my MP-7 any way? Does upgrading it make the MP-7 function 
better or something?

Re: Another Question!

2003-03-08 by mikexl7

the new OS's are more stable and offer some new features, and there 
free so why not improve your XL.

You load it into the XL with the eloader aplication that came with 
your xl.  Just downlad the newest OS from the emu site.  Then conect 
the midi in and out to your computer (assuming that you have one).  
The rest of the information you will need can be found in the read 
me file that comes with the new OS.

It is pretty easy to do.  

I recomend that you back up your patterns before you upgrade just in 
case some thing weird happens.

Yes, upgrading makes your MP7 work MUCH better, since many of the original
resellers (Guitar Center, etc.) bought a large number of them and still have
older inventory.  So when you get your device it may not be that "new".  To
upgrade you will have to go to the EMU site and download eLoader, install tht
then follow the instructions on that page for updating your OS.  You will need a
midi interface with  free in/out and you will probaly want to turn off all the
other synths on the chain.
